Frohn GmbH, part of WINOA Group, is an internationally operating, medium-sized industrial company headquartered in Altena, Germany, with additional locations in the United States, Brazil, and China. As a leading manufacturer of high-performance blasting media, cut-wire and related accessories, Frohn GmbH combines decades of technical expertise with a strong commitment to quality and customer service.

Responsibilities
- Conduct market research to identify the best products and suppliers in terms of value, delivery schedules, and quality.
- Implement the Group’s sourcing strategy and policies in alignment with corporate strategy and values.
- Lead specific purchasing categories to meet internal customer needs with optimal service levels and competitive costs.
- Take a leading role in negotiations, negotiate contracts, and monitor supplier service quality and performance.
- Review, compare, analyze, and approve products and services to be purchased.
- Provide accurate management information and reporting to support global projects and overall company strategy.
Missions
- Manage the end-to-end purchasing process from requisition to delivery.
- Ensure timely follow-up with suppliers and guarantee on-time delivery by expediting orders, tracking shipments, and resolving customs clearance issues.
- Act as a key interface between suppliers, manufacturers, and internal departments such as Supply Chain, Marketing, IT, and Sales.
- Identify, evaluate, and onboard potential suppliers based on company requirements; assess and manage supplier performance to drive continuous improvement.
- Negotiate contracts and secure advantageous commercial terms and deadlines.
- Monitor and update price fluctuations, forecast market trends, and analyze their impact on future activities.
- Develop and implement processes and strategies to achieve or exceed cost-saving and supplier performance targets.
- Ensure suppliers understand and align with business objectives.
- Prepare budgets, cost analyses, and procurement reports.
